An extinguisher designed for use with a dry chemical only (ABC powder) like the one on the left in the figure is pressurized to 195 psi (1,344 kPa).
This is a powder-based agent that extinguishes by separating the three parts of the fire triangle. It prevents the chemical reactions involving heat, fuel, and oxygen, thus extinguishing the fire. During combustion, the fuel breaks down into free radicals, which are highly reactive fragments of molecules that react with oxygen. The substances in dry chemical extinguishers can stop this process.

The average pressurized water extinguisher discharges two and half gallons of water for up to one minute, with an effective range that falls between thirty to forty feet. This particular type of extinguisher smothers fires by cooling the burning material below the ignition point.

How does a compressed gas fire extinguisher work?
They are then pressurized with an expellant gas, normally dry nitrogen or dry air within the same cylinder. The extinguisher valve and its related components keep the compressed gas from escaping until operated. Over time, like an old or worn car tire, a fire extinguisher can develop a slow leak that releases the gas.

What is the difference between gas and aerosol fire extinguishers?
To the difference of gaseous suppressants, which emit only gas, and dry chemical extinguishers, which release powder-like particles of a large size (25–150 µm) condensed aerosols are defined by the National Fire Protection Association as releasing finely divided solid particles (generally <10 µm), usually in addition to gas.
Is it dangerous to use a depressurized fire extinguisher?
The dangers of depressurized fire extinguishers While a leaking or depressurized fire extinguisher isn’t dangerous in and of itself (the gas won’t cause damage to people, for example), its dangers are nevertheless serious. A lack of pressure causes a fire extinguisher to be inoperable.
